Phase 2a Trial Launches for Systemic Sclerosis
Mediar has initiated the EncompaSSc trial, a randomized, double-blinded, placebo-controlled 24-week Phase 2a study designed to evaluate the efficacy, safety, and tolerability of MTX-474 in approximately 90 patients living with SSc. The study uses the validated Modified Rodnan Skin Score (mRSS) tool as the primary endpoint.

Novel Mechanism of Action
MTX-474 is a first-in-class human IgG1 antibody designed to neutralize EphrinB2 (搜索) signaling that causes the onset and progression of fibrosis (搜索). Ephrin ligands and Eph receptors mediate biological processes involved in tissue fibrosis including cell migration, myofibroblast activation, and tissue remodeling. A growing body of evidence has implicated EphrinB2 in the fibrosis of the skin, lungs, and heart. Expression of EphrinB2 and its receptors are measurable in human blood and correlates with disease severity.
Expanding Pipeline Across Multiple Fibrotic Conditions
The company is also advancing MTX-439 (搜索), a first-in-class human IgG1 antibody engineered to inhibit the activity of SPARC-related modular calcium-binding protein 2 (SMOC2 (搜索)). SMOC2 has been shown to promote extracellular matrix assembly and cell adhesiveness and is a driver of renal fibrosis (搜索). SMOC2 levels are elevated in patients with chronic kidney disease (搜索), both in the tissue and in circulation. MTX-439 selectively binds to SMOC2 and neutralizes its activity, significantly reducing fibrosis in multiple preclinical models.
Mediar is finalizing an IND-enabling package for MTX-439 (搜索) for the treatment of fibrosis (搜索) associated with chronic kidney disease (搜索), with plans to initiate Phase 1 studies in the first half of 2026.
Additionally, MTX-463, a first-in-class human IgG1 antibody developed against WNT1-inducible signaling pathway protein-1 (WISP1 (搜索)), is currently in a Phase 2 study for idiopathic pulmonary fibrosis (搜索) (IPF) in partnership with Eli Lilly and Company. WISP1 is a secreted matricellular protein shown to have a relevant role in fibrosis (搜索) progression, is measurable in human blood, and correlates with disease severity.

Mediar Therapeutics (搜索) is pioneering a new approach to fibrosis (搜索) treatment that aims to halt the disease at a different source – the myofibroblast, the key pathogenic cell in fibrosis that drives scarring, disease progression, and ultimately organ failure. The company combines novel targets with reliable, easily detectable blood biomarkers and familiar modalities to develop anti-fibrotic therapies with a potential precision medicine approach.
